On 25 April, the UK government launched its Transition Plan Taskforce (TPT) to develop a transition plan disclosure framework. There are other areas in which the TPT will have to set their own expectations, spanning from reliance on carbonoffsetting and carbon capture and storage (CCS) technologies to transparency on climate lobbying. .
Climate change considerations are also fast becoming a cornerstone in Singapore's national development. The country has committed to unconditionally reducing GHG emissions intensity by 36 percent from 2005 levels, and to peak its carbon emissions by 2030.
